The No Huddle Offense- Why did it work in Buffalo but not for Chip Kelly? by AlbertJBundy in NFLv2

[–]Damion__205 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Agreed, some of his innovations were ahead of the time. Nutrition being one of the big ones.

But his unyielding requirement to his way and only his way for all things is what doomed him in the pros... Sadly, his failure twice in the pros probably helped lead to him not being able to pull college kids when he went back.

I don't hold any malice to him for failing as a head coach of my team. I knew it was likely when he was signed. After years of arrogance from Harbaugh and Roman I knew the stubborn unwaivering commitment isn't how the pros work.
